Husby-Sjuhundra Church: A Journey through Time

This historic church stands as a testament to Sweden's medieval roots. Did you know it dates back to the late 12th century?

Founded by unknown artisans, Husby-Sjuhundra Church has retained its original architecture, showcasing Romanesque style. The church is noteworthy for its distinctive materials and rich history, marking it as a vital site in the region's religious and cultural narrative.
